    @kiwiinmelb Yes its much easier said than done, similar to Fury v Klitschko when people said that Klitschko needed to just let his hands go - more like he couldn't as Fury was just waiting for him to throw and fall short so Fury could counter as his control of the distance that night was some of the best you'll ever see.

    Yes, Ushk has had his troubles with pressure fighters that are smaller like Chisora and Briedis, but its their specific style of fighting (Briedis to be fair has a bit more to his game), AJ can't fight like that and won't be able to change that overnight.

    It was a great day out even if the main fight was a bit lacklustre.

    Devin played it safe sitting behind his superior jab controlling the tempo and distance, and George needed to find a way to close the distance to up the tempo but he looked a bit lost how to do that , when he did do it devin grabbed him .full props for Haney executing his fight plan . Marketing the rematch might be a hard sell.

    Yeah the kiwi boys a bit disappointing, I probably didn’t rate fa that highly anyway , but nyika I had hopes for , but seemed a bit trying to impress a bit with all the switch hitting/ showboating but lacking in fundamentals, overall got hit too much. He wouldn’t want to be doing that with the big hitters of the division .
